Thomas Gottschalk addresses fans following ZDF appearance

0

The recent appearance of Thomas Gottschalk on ZDF has stirred up quite a controversy, with many viewers expressing their dismay at his performance. Some viewers went as far as to comment that he seemed to have lost his touch, with one person remarking, “Boy, has he declined. Almost scary.” Another viewer criticized Gottschalk as a complete mismatch for a quiz show, stating, “Gottschalk simply knows nothing.” The TV host was invited by moderator Johannes B. Kerner to serve as an expert in film and television on the ZDF program “Der Quiz-Champion,” where he was easily defeated by three contestants, with scores of 3:1, 3:2, and 3:0.

Despite the negative reactions, Thomas Gottschalk took to Instagram on the day of the TV broadcast to offer a surprising explanation for his performance. In a post, he expressed his appreciation for Johannes B. Kerner and other colleagues who he respects, which was the reason he accepted the invitation to the show, even though he admitted to having limited knowledge in the field of film and television. Gottschalk revealed that he has been more involved in both areas than simply being an observer.

For Gottschalk, the evening of the “Quiz-Champion” was a success, as he was delighted to reconnect with acquaintances such as Jürgen von der Lippe and Wigald Boning. He also praised the contestants, describing them as “truly top” and just as knowledgeable as the experts. At 75, his motto is now to only engage in activities that bring him joy.

The online community’s reactions to Gottschalk’s performance were mixed, with some users expressing pity and suggesting that it may be time for him to step back from the TV spotlight. On the other hand, there were individuals defending Gottschalk, emphasizing the need to show him respect and gratitude rather than ridicule. The ongoing debate revolves around the question of when it is appropriate for a TV personality to retire from the limelight.

As Gottschalk prepares to bid farewell to “Denn Sie wissen nicht, was passiert!” on RTL in December, other prominent figures such as Günther Jauch and Barbara Schöneberger are also rumored to be exiting the show. Despite the varied opinions and speculations surrounding his recent appearance, Thomas Gottschalk remains unfazed, focused on pursuing activities that bring him joy and fulfillment in his later years.
